#if DEBUG
using System;
using ICSharpCode.Decompiler.DebugSteps;
namespace ICSharpCode.ILSpy.Languages
{
/// <summary>
/// A language that surfaces a <see cref="Stepper"/> of decompiler-pipeline steps for the
/// Debug Steps pane to visualise. Implemented by <see cref="ILAstLanguage"/> (one node per IL
/// transform step) and <see cref="CSharpLanguage"/> (one node per C# AST transform). The pane
/// binds to whichever current language is an <see cref="IDebugStepProvider"/>, so it no longer has to
/// know the concrete language type.
/// </summary>
internal interface IDebugStepProvider
{
/// <summary>The step tree produced by the most recent full decompile.</summary>
Stepper Stepper { get; }
/// <summary>Raised after a full (non step-limited) decompile refreshes <see cref="Stepper"/>.</summary>
event EventHandler? StepperUpdated;
/// <summary>
/// Language-specific options object the Debug Steps pane renders above the step tree
/// (e.g. ILAst's writing-options checkboxes), or <see langword="null"/> when the language
/// has no step options. The pane picks a template by the object's runtime type, so each
/// language contributes its own controls.
/// </summary>
object? StepOptions { get; }
}
}
#endif
